Introduction to Energy Storage Power Stations

Definition and Function

An energy storage power station is a facility that balances the power grid load and stabilizes power supply by storing electrical energy and releasing it during peak power demand. It is a crucial component of the modern power system, acting as a buffer and regulator between various power sources and power demands, effectively improving the system's voltage and frequency regulation capabilities.

Working Principle

Basic Composition

An energy storage power station mainly consists of a battery energy storage system, an energy management system (EMS), charging and discharging equipment, an inverter, and a monitoring system. The battery energy storage system is the core, usually using different types of energy storage devices such as lithium - ion batteries, sodium - sulfur batteries, and lead - acid batteries. The energy management system is responsible for the intelligent scheduling of the battery charging and discharging process, and the inverter converts the stored direct current into alternating current for supply to the power grid.

Specific Stages

  • Charging Stage: When the power grid load is low or the power generation from renewable energy sources such as wind and solar is high, the energy storage power station stores the excess electrical energy into the battery through its connection to the power grid. This process is precisely scheduled by the intelligent energy management system to ensure maximum energy storage efficiency.
  • Discharging Stage: When the power grid load is high or the power generation from renewable energy sources is insufficient, the energy storage power station converts the stored electrical energy into alternating current through the inverter and supplies it to the power grid, which is crucial for regulating the frequency of the power grid and maintaining voltage stability.

Significance of Construction

Improving Power Quality

Power quality refers to a set of complete indicators that enable electrical appliances and systems to operate as intended, avoiding significant waste of performance. In the 21st century, the trend of power quality standards is to provide power without sags, spikes, disruptions, and interruptions. Energy storage power stations can, to a certain extent, ensure power quality, preventing problems such as equipment malfunctions, premature failures, or inability to operate due to poor power quality. This is of great significance, especially for highly secure applications in key places such as hospitals and emergency service departments.

Achieving Higher Asset Utilization

In the power industry, demand is difficult to predict accurately, and utilities need to be prepared to meet peak power consumption at all times. Storage technologies can provide an economic buffer and safety factor to meet demand. The cost of storing power produced during off - peak hours can be offset by its value during peak hours, and it can also reduce new capital investment in new equipment.

Enhancing the Development of Renewable Energy

Renewable energy sources such as wind and solar energy are variable and difficult to predict. Energy storage power stations can store excess renewable energy, solve problems related to renewable energy, and help these technologies develop more rapidly and achieve a larger market scale.

Application Scenarios

Large - scale Power Supply

Traditional large - scale power plants such as thermal and nuclear power plants have relatively small fluctuations in power supply. However, with the increasing proportion of renewable energy, ensuring the stability of the power grid has become a problem. Energy storage power stations can release the stored electrical energy in a timely manner according to the changes in the power grid load, ensuring the continuity and stability of power supply, and are a powerful assistant to power companies and power systems.

Distributed Energy Field

With the popularization of distributed power generation systems such as solar and wind energy, many households and commercial users install small - scale energy storage power stations to achieve self - sufficiency or reduce electricity costs. In areas with large fluctuations in electricity prices, energy storage power stations can help users store electricity when the price is low and discharge it during peak - price periods.
